Requirements


Must have:

We seek a candidate with a solid grasp of Advanced Metering Infrastructure (AMI) and Automatic Meter Reading (AMR) systems. Experience in the Electric Utility sector is essential, alongside a capability to troubleshoot applications across various platforms, including desktops, laptops, mobile devices, and Toughbooks. The ideal applicant will have experience in monitoring complex applications and possess data analytics expertise to analyze and modify flat files. Familiarity with operating within an Oracle environment is crucial, including the ability to read and write Oracle SQL queries and manage stored procedure coding and optimization. Proven experience in analyzing log files for troubleshooting and debugging applications in a multi-platform context is highly valued. Additionally, the candidate should have a background in functional and technical architecture, design, development, testing, and system integration. Proficiency in development methodologies and tools (.NET, VB, C#), database platforms (Oracle/SQL Server, Linux), web platforms (IIS, Apache, .NET, Adobe Flex, JavaScript, HTML), and client platforms (Citrix, Windows OS) is required. Candidates must also be pro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Access, Word, PowerPoint, SharePoint).

Responsibilities:


In this role, I will expect you to outline and establish the system scope and objectives through thorough research, application monitoring, and fact-finding to create or modify moderately complex information systems. You will be responsible for preparing detailed specifications from which programmers will work. You will collaborate with a specific business unit within a multi-platform environment on multiple project assignments. Additionally, you will guide and mentor junior Systems Analysts and perform other duties as needed to support our team’s objectives.
